Question : 26

Who is authorized to transfer the judges of one High Court to another High Court?

a) The Law Minister

b) A collegium of judges of the Supreme Court.

c) The President

d) The Chief Justice of India

Answer: (c)

The President may, after consultation with the Chief Justice of India, transfer a judge from one high court to any other high court. Question : 28 [SSC CGL 2004]

Who is empowered to transfer a Judge from one High Court to another High Court?

a) Chief Justice of India

b) Law Minister of India

c) The Union Cabinet

d) President of India

Answer: (d)

Article 222 empowers the President to transfer judges from one High Court to another. Clause (2) of this article goes on to provide that when a judge is so transferred he shall be entitled to receive in addition to his salary a compensatory allowance.

Question : 29 [UGC-II 2016]

Which one of the following statements is not correct regarding Certiorari?

a) A High Court can issue certiorari to a tribunal situated within its jurisdiction

b) A High Court cannot issue a writ to another High Court

c) A High Court can issue a writ against itself in its administrative capacity

d) A bench of a High Court can issue a writ to another bench of the same High Court

Answer: (d)

A bench of a High court is equal to the High court in all judicial powers. Hence a bench of the High court cannot issue certiorari against the order of another bench.
